Motherless Child

Though Juneteenth (June 19th) is a day of celebration, it is also a reminder of how much suffering has been and continues to be caused by racism in America and throughout the world. As a white person trying to comprehend the pain of racism, I have always found the African American spiritual Sometimes I Feel Like a Motherless Child a moving metaphor that conveys some of the emotional pain that racism inflicts.
